Frame rates, side by side
| Game | Medion Erazer Beast X20 | Gigabyte A5 X1 | Diff |
|---|---|---|---|
| Dota 2 | 123 | 131 | -8 |
| Far Cry 5 | 110 | 114 | -4 |
| Final Fantasy XV | 92 | 95 | -3 |
| GTA V | 153 | 155 | -2 |
| Strange Brigade | 192 | 179 | +13 |
| The Witcher 3 | 180 | 171 | +9 |
| X-Plane 11 | 70 | 76 | -6 |
1920×1080, High preset, upscaling off. Source: Notebookcheck.
Specifications
| Medion Erazer Beast X20 | Gigabyte A5 X1 | |
|---|---|---|
| Price | — | — |
| GPU | RTX 3070 | RTX 3070 |
| GPU power | 140W | 140W |
| CPU | Core i7-10870H | Ryzen 9 5900HX |
| Memory | 32GB | 16GB |
| Display | 17.3in 2560x1440 | 15.6in 1920x1080 |
| Refresh | 165Hz | 240Hz |
| Weight | 2.246kg | 2.189kg |
| Score | Not scored - no UK price | Not scored - no UK price |
How these numbers were produced
Frame rates here are not measured by us, and we label how each one was arrived at. A figure marked measured comes from a published run on that exact machine. A figure marked representative is derived from the GPU and its power limit (TGP) and cross-referenced against published reviews - a sound estimate of what that configuration delivers, but not a measurement of that specific laptop. Unless stated otherwise, numbers are 1920x1080, High preset, upscaling off. Where a laptop ships in several power configurations we use the wattage of the exact SKU listed, because a 140W RTX 5070 and a 115W one are not the same product.
